Spell Bee Word: thorny

Basic Details

Word: Thorny

Part of Speech: Adjective

Meaning: Having thorns; difficult or complicated; full of problems.

Synonyms: Prickly, spiny, challenging, troublesome

Antonyms: Smooth, easy, simple

Idioms and Phrases

  1. On thorny ground: In a situation that is difficult or delicate. Example: "The negotiation was on thorny ground, with both sides having conflicting interests."
  2. A thorn in someone's side: A person or thing causing constant annoyance. Example: "The constant noise from the construction site was a thorn in her side."

Usage Examples

Example 1: Be careful when walking through the bushes; they are quite thorny and can scratch your skin.

Example 2: The thorny issue of environmental protection requires careful discussion to find a solution.

Example 3: He decided to avoid thorny topics at the family gathering to keep the atmosphere pleasant.
